I received an email about the programming test with a link to hackerrank.
This test took long time as it was vague and need to understand the whole workflow. They had their own linux based platform inside the hackerrank setup. We have to use terminal to run the program. There were certain test scripts which read the text instructions and used to produce the output. To do outside in our local environment we need to setup and it will be tedious so I tried doing it in the terminal itself.
The test had a time limit of 3 days and we need to complete by that time. I did in my leisure intervals and was able to complete it after learning few things and able to use based on the test instructions. I submitted the code and communicated the same to recruiter. Programming test related to weather application which has some stubs that need to be completed and tested based on the instructions that are provided. Also we need to add new APIs and workflow. The entire thing is like a project with pom and also a terminal application embedded inside hackerrank specifically for Capital One
For a senior manager position, the interviews were leaning more towards hand-on coding than average. Definitely need to brush up on coding skills if you want to do well on these EM interviews. There was also a design system question on virtual credit cards.

Started with a recruiter call for initial screening. Basic questions to determine fit and relevant skills. After that they send Code screen link with three leetcode type questions followed by four hours of Power Day interviews.
Coding interview for a senior software engineering manager is a hassle if not necessary. They give you examples of coding interview questions ahead of time to prepare. eg. LeetCode or CodeSignal
